
Golden Rule Plaza
1050 New Jersey Avenue, NW, Washington, DC
Number of Units
119
Year Developed
2003
Development Costs
$18.3 million
Goal
New construction of affordable senior housing
Description
Since 1989, Golden Rule Plaza Inc., a nonprofit affiliate of Bible Way Church, had sought to bring affordable senior housing to its community on land adjacent to the Church. In 2001, Mission First was brought in as a development partner and helped achieve that vision.
The new construction development at 1050 New Jersey Avenue NW provides 119 units of high quality apartment housing for seniors in a 7-story building. It is located in a rapidly developing area between Mt. Vernon Triangle and NOMA. Project amenities include a large community room and kitchen, an exercise room and a landscaped outdoor patio.
The project was financed with tax exempt bonds issues by the DC Housing Finance Agency under the HUD risk share program, gap financing provided by the DC Department of Housing and Community Development, FHLB Atlanta AHP grant funds and low income housing tax credit equity through RBC Capital Markets.
